Signs that it's time to replace your double mattress

While the lifespan of a mattress can vary depending on factors such as quality and usage, there are some tell-tale signs that it's time for a replacement.

The first sign is visible sagging or lumps in the mattress. Over time, the springs and foam in a mattress can lose their support, resulting in sagging areas that can cause discomfort and disrupt your sleep.

Another sign is discomfort or pain. If you're waking up with aches and pains in your neck, back, or hips, it's time to consider a new mattress. A good mattress should provide adequate support and cushioning for your body, reducing pressure on your joints and muscles.

If you're noticing more dust or allergens in your bedroom, it could be a sign that your mattress is reaching the end of its life. Old mattresses can become breeding grounds for dust mites and other allergens, leading to potential health issues.

Lastly, if your mattress is over 7-10 years old, it's time to start thinking about a replacement. Even if it still looks and feels okay, the materials inside may have deteriorated, leading to reduced support and comfort.

The lifespan of a double mattress

The lifespan of a double mattress can vary depending on several factors, including the quality of the materials, the amount of use, and the weight of the sleeper.

On average, a good quality double mattress should last between 7-10 years with proper care and maintenance. However, if you're heavier or sleep on the mattress every night, it may wear out faster.

Factors that affect the lifespan of a mattress include the amount of use, the quality of the materials, and the weight of the sleeper.

If you're looking to extend the life of your double mattress, there are several things you can do, such as rotating it regularly, using a mattress protector, and avoiding jumping or standing on it.

When it comes to choosing a new double mattress, there are several factors to consider, including your sleeping position, body type, and personal preferences.

Firstly, consider your sleeping position. If you're a side sleeper, you'll want a mattress that provides pressure relief for your hips and shoulders. If you're a back or stomach sleeper, you'll need a firmer mattress that supports your spine.

Secondly, consider your body type. If you're heavier, you'll want a mattress with more support and durability. If you're lighter, you'll need a softer mattress to prevent discomfort and pressure points.

Lastly, consider your personal preferences. Do you prefer a firm or soft mattress? Do you like a mattress with a lot of bounce or one that absorbs motion? These factors will affect your overall comfort and satisfaction with your new mattress.

To ensure the longevity of your new double mattress, there are several things you can do:

- Rotate your mattress regularly to prevent sagging and wear.

- Use a mattress protector to prevent stains and spills.

- Avoid standing or jumping on the mattress.

- Keep pets off the bed to prevent damage and odours.

- Clean your mattress regularly to remove dust and allergens.

By taking care of your mattress, you can ensure that it lasts for many years, providing you with the support and comfort you need for a restful night's sleep.
